Output d44325acedab9dd3bc8aec30ca667c813421626de0f2e5ef98ac888e628604f6:21

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5b59ebc0881aba8e7ab815ed6ae230e9573dffa420aa3c42005059bcdb6c0de0
address
bc1ptdv7hsygr2agu74czhkk4c3sa9tnmlayyz4rcssq2pvmekmvphsq8a59yg
transaction
d44325acedab9dd3bc8aec30ca667c813421626de0f2e5ef98ac888e628604f6
spent
true